BAKU, Azerbaijan, July 1

Trend:

The Working Group on Economic Issues of the Interdepartmental Center under the Coordination Headquarters, created for the centralized solution of issues in Azerbaijan’s liberated territories, discussed inventorization of real estate objects in the territories at its meeting, Trend reports on July 1.

According to the group, work on inventorization of 13,307 real estate objects (10,483 buildings and 2,824 infrastructure facilities) has been completed in Jabrayil, Fuzuli, Gubadly, Zangilan, Aghdam, Khojavand, Tartar, Shusha, Khojaly and Kalbajar districts.

The meeting participants said that a preliminary inventorization of roads with a length of 1,525 kilometers, a power transmission line with a length of 292 kilometers, gas supply lines with a length of 45 kilometers, water pipelines with a length of 19 kilometers, an irrigation network with a total length of 249 kilometers were completed.

Besides, using orthophoto maps, lands with a total area of ​​533,000 hectares were vectorized and entered into the electronic information base.

Moreover, in 177 settlements of 10 districts, work on a preliminary inventory of real estate has been completed. In two settlements, the work will continue. In addition, the destruction of 409 settlements was identified.

The districts had been liberated from Armenian occupation due to the Second Karabakh War (from late Sept. to early November 2020).
